How many carbs are in a Waffle?

A 1 round (75g) serving of Waffle contains 24.7g of total carbs (23.7g net carbs), 3.4g sugar, 218 calories, 5.9g protein, 10.7g fat and 1g fiber.

Blood-sugar impact of Waffle

Moderate glycemic impact expected. If you're monitoring blood sugar, keep an eye on total portion size and combine with protein or fat.

With 24.7g total carbs and 1g fiber, the net-carb figure for a 1 round (75g) serving works out to roughly 23.7g — this is the number most keto and low-carb tracking apps use. If you're managing type 2 diabetes, pre-diabetes or reactive hypoglycemia, use total carbs for insulin dosing calculations and treat net carbs as a rough guide for meal planning.

Sources & how these numbers are calculated

Nutrition values are consensus averages compiled from the USDA FoodData Central database for a typical 1 round (75g) serving of Waffle. Actual values vary with brand, variety, ripeness and preparation — always check the label on packaged products. Daily-value percentages reference the U.S. FDA 2,000-calorie adult reference (275g carbs, 50g added sugar, 50g protein, 78g fat, 28g fiber).
